Publié par le 12 juin 2010, 0 commentaire

C’est dans sa simplicité et sa compatibilité entre les navigateurs que jQuery a réussi à se distinguer. Beaucoup des utilisateurs utilisent jQuery car il permet une transversalité entre les navigateurs web du moment (et même les anciens).

Le module AJAX de jQuery est un des éléments avantageux et sans qui il serait laborieux de faire l’AJAX dans ses applications JavaScript. Personnellement, je l’utilise tous les jours, et c’est compatible avec tout ce que j’ai testé (même mon Nokia 5800 ExpressMusic et l’Iphone d’un collègue).

Donc rapidement, je vais vous balancer un code permettant de gérer de l’AJAX avec jQuery :

$.ajax({
type: "GET", // ou POST
url: "ajax.php", // l'url de mon fichier AJAX
data: "name=John&location=Boston", // les datas, seulement en POST, car en get on peut les  mettre dans l'url
async: false, // le mode d'exécution de la requête : true : on bloque le navigateur en attendant  la réponse de la page AJAX, false on peut continuer à utiliser le site même si la requête est en  cours
success: function(data){ // une fonction anonyme qui sera exécuté lors en cas de succès.
alert( "Résultat de ma requête : " + data);
}
});

Voilà, rapidement, je vous conseil le GET en mode asynchrone à « true », cela permettra de ne pas rendre le navigateur « instable » et pas de réponse dans le cas ou le serveur planterai.

Tags: , , , , ,

0 commentaire

Pas de commentaire.

Flux RSS des commentaires de cet article. TrackBack URL

Laisser un commentaire

*